The work of a locksmith entails the installation and maintenance of different types of locks. Locksmiths are responsible for the installation and maintenance of locks and also make keys and alter combinations. Locksmiths can also repair locks on desks and display cases and also change lock combinations and operate codes machines to ensure locks are safe. Locksmiths are also able to assist with Master Key Systems. This involves keeping track of hardware changes and refilling the cylinders.

A Locksmith is required to have a high school diploma. You will be eligible for this job if your have at least a high school diploma. But, you can also become a 24-hour locksmith without a college degree. Locksmiths typically start as apprentices, gaining valuable experience before becoming certified. Through this training you'll be taught the fundamentals of the trade, which includes how to open locks and make keys. You'll then be ready to enter the field.

Whatever the location you work in locksmiths must be fit and healthy. They must be able climb ladders and lift heavy objects, as well as work for long periods of time. Additionally, they should be able of working for long hours. A locksmith must have excellent customer service skills. They often work directly with customers. Therefore, it's essential that they are able to communicate effectively and be able to respond to any questions that arise.

The responsibilities of a locksmith vary and can include repair, installation, or replacement of locks. They could also be accountable for changing locks or installing new locks. Locksmiths are part of a firm's security team and 24-hour locksmith are able to provide emergency lockout services. They inspect locks on a regular basis to ensure the security of employees, customers, and guests. Locksmiths who are available 24 hours a day need to be trustworthy and professional when dealing with emergency situations.

Cost to hire a 24 hour locksmith

There are many variables that influence the cost of a 24 hr lock smith-hour locksmith, including the type of lock and whereabouts. Also, you should consider the cost of the trip that can range from $25 and $100. While a trip is not terribly expensive, it could become more expensive if you live in a rural location. If you require immediate assistance, it is best to call a 24 hour locksmith and schedule an appointment for non-peak times.

Emergency locksmiths are not typically local to your area, so the cost they charge will reflect the effort and time they'll need to make on your behalf. A typical emergency locksmith bill will vary from $150 to $250, based on time of day and location. It is important to know, however, that these costs are not inclusive of travel expenses, minimum fees, or other charges. Even even if you're insured, it may not cover the cost for an emergency locksmith.

Locksmiths can do many services, 24-hour locksmith including lock repair. While you might think of them when you're locked out of your car, they can also help people with lockouts in their homes or offices. Other services that they provide are also accessible. The cost of a 24-hour locksmith will be based on the kind of service and its location. In addition emergency services will generally be more expensive than other types of service. For instance the replacement of an ignition cylinder will cost more than replacing a lock.

While you can get an estimate of the cost of a 24- hour locksmith however, it is important to know that the cost can vary greatly depending on the time of day and the complexity of the problem. A locksmith will cost more if they need to be called on weekends or nights. In general, an emergency locksmith job can cost between $100 and $200. And, if the emergency is urgent and you require a locksmith 24 hours a day, a 24hr locksmith will charge more.

After you've determined the cost of hiring a 24 hour locksmith, you must determine what kind of service you'll need. If you require locksmiths to repair digital locks, it's crucial to choose a locksmith who has experience with these types of locks. Additionally, it's important to be aware that some locksmiths charge extra if you need them outside of their normal work hours. Make sure to wait until the price is lower to avoid an extra fee.

You can expect to pay minimum $75, based on the lock you need. If you require an upgraded lock system you could spend up to $150. Rekeying, for instance it will cost you between $20 to $30 per hole, based on the level of the locksmith's experience. Also, think about whether your locks should be re-keyed or replaced.
